Output 84d4fe106d03e28e09cf6b395589ccd3d7e71b7a28e7fa038aac5577764ccd57:5

value
15948
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3a0d27065ae8bec60951821be26e29250540aa3240183f570709f450a54272b
address
bc1p6wsdyur94697ccy4rqsmufhzjfg9gz4rysqc8atswz052zj5yu4s8dcvwj
transaction
84d4fe106d03e28e09cf6b395589ccd3d7e71b7a28e7fa038aac5577764ccd57
spent
true